Off, off, and away: Prairie View A&M University Hosts Freshman Send-off Celebrations

Prairie View A&M University held the first of three 2018 freshman send-off celebrations on Saturday, August 4, at The Buffalo Soldiers National Museum in Houston, Texas.

 

Called Destination Pantherland, these festive send-off receptions welcome incoming freshman and parents to The Hill with special guests from career services, athletics, alumni affairs, including Panther cheerleaders and mascot, to share the many ways PVAMU is unique and field various questions.

 

ā€œWe know that the future is very bright at Prairie View and it is a delight to share those infinite possibilities with the Class of 2022 before many of them even start class,ā€ said Carme Williams, vice president of development. ā€œDestination Pantherland is a celebration of our studentsā€™ achievements past, present, and future.ā€

 

At the event, attended by approximately 100 guests, the university also launched its new Panther Parent Program which links parents and guardians with important resources, events, and information about the university to help advance the academic success of our students.

 

ā€œAs parents and guardians, we know our children better than anyone and are positioned to take an active role in preparing our kids for something bigger and better,ā€ said Panther Parent Program Ambassadors Renee and Mark Falls ā€™82 who were also in attendance at the inaugural event. ā€œWe are honored to help all students get ready for this world through the Panther Parent Program.ā€

Each Destination Pantherland event is held in partnership with local alumni chapters, further connecting new students with their forever Panther Family. Upcoming Destination Pantherland events will be held on Saturday, August 11, in Dallas, Texas, and Saturday, August 18, in Ft. Worth, Texas.
